Tell us about the area the post box is situated.:
Lombard St is in the City of London. It gets its name from the Lombardy region of (what is now) Italy, the origin of bankers/goldsmiths (depending on which source you read). Some sources say that the land of Lombard street was granted to goldmiths from Lombardy by Edward I.
